Veery 0E [Care Weather Technologies]
Veery 0E (Veery v0.3, Fledgling Veery Ectobius) is a picosatellite developed by Care Weather Technologies to the 1U CubeSat form factor as a technology demonstrator for their planned Veery wind scatterometer satellites.
Ectobius will launch on the SpaceX Transporter 10 mission. After launch, it'll deploy its antenna and commission its radio, pointing sensors, and pointing actuators.
Ectobius' tests include fully radio data rate stress testing and radar detection of the Earth.
Ectobius will also be available to amateur radio operators to use as a mailbox, digipeater, and telemetering station for the study of cubesat thermals.
